From 397d29e3375fa342f33c298b6b8be1de64c5fa72 Mon Sep 17 00:00:00 2001 From: Thibault Duplessis Date: Tue, 1 Oct 2013 22:37:11 +0200 Subject: [PATCH] monitor AI remotes --- app/AiStresser.scala | 12 ++++++------ app/controllers/Monitor.scala | 2 +- app/views/monitor/monitor.scala.html | 3 ++- modules/ai/src/main/Env.scala | 2 ++ public/javascripts/monitor.js | 28 ++++++++++++++++++---------- 5 files changed, 29 insertions(+), 18 deletions(-) diff --git a/app/AiStresser.scala b/app/AiStresser.scala index ad706a70ce..af752d4f50 100644 --- a/app/AiStresser.scala +++ b/app/AiStresser.scala @@ -12,16 +12,16 @@ private[app] final class AiStresser(env: lila.ai.Env, system: ActorSystem) { def apply { - (1 to 10) foreach { i ⇒ + (1 to 20) foreach { i ⇒ system.scheduler.scheduleOnce((i * 97) millis) { play(i % 8 + 1, true) } } - (1 to 3) foreach { i ⇒ - system.scheduler.scheduleOnce((i * 131) millis) { - analyse(true) - } - } + // (1 to 3) foreach { i ⇒ + // system.scheduler.scheduleOnce((i * 131) millis) { + // analyse(true) + // } + // } } diff --git a/app/controllers/Monitor.scala b/app/controllers/Monitor.scala index f8c93494d6..9f614cfe83 100644 --- a/app/controllers/Monitor.scala +++ b/app/controllers/Monitor.scala @@ -14,7 +14,7 @@ object Monitor extends LilaController { private def env = Env.monitor def index = Action { - Ok(views.html.monitor.monitor()) + Ok(views.html.monitor.monitor(Env.ai.nbStockfishRemotes)) } def websocket = Socket[JsValue] { implicit ctx ⇒ diff --git a/app/views/monitor/monitor.scala.html b/app/views/monitor/monitor.scala.html index 7b47ee90de..ab6ca5d292 100644 --- a/app/views/monitor/monitor.scala.html +++ b/app/views/monitor/monitor.scala.html @@ -1,4 +1,4 @@ -@() +@(nbAi: Int) @layout("Lichess monitor") { < back to lichess @@ -10,6 +10,7 @@ Emergency reactor shutdown - DON'T CLICK